Interface ElementBaseGeneratorContext
-
- All Superinterfaces:
org.eclipse.emf.ecore.EObject
,IElementGeneratorContext
,org.eclipse.emf.common.notify.Notifier
- All Known Subinterfaces:
CalendarFieldGeneratorContext
,ChartGeneratorContext
,CheckBoxAsTumblerGeneratorContext
,CheckBoxGeneratorContext
,CommandBarGeneratorContext
,ContextMenuGeneratorContext
,DendrogramGeneratorContext
,FlowchartGeneratorContext
,FormattedDocGeneratorContext
,FormButtonGeneratorContext
,GanttChartGeneratorContext
,GeographicalMapGeneratorContext
,GroupBaseGeneratorContext
,HTMLGeneratorContext
,HyperlinkButtonGeneratorContext
,ImageFieldGeneratorContext
,InputFieldGeneratorContext
,LogicGroupGeneratorContext
,MainElementGeneratorContext
,MenuButtonGeneratorContext
,MenuButtonsGroupGeneratorContext
,MoxelGeneratorContext
,NavigatorGeneratorContext
,PageGeneratorContext
,PagesGeneratorContext
,PanelGeneratorContext
,PeriodFieldGeneratorContext
,PictureDecorationGeneratorContext
,PlannerGeneratorContext
,ProgressBarGeneratorContext
,RadioGroupAsTumblerGeneratorContext
,RadioGroupGeneratorContext
,RichElementBaseGeneratorContext
,RichFieldBaseGeneratorContext
,SearchControlElementAdditionInFormGeneratorContext
,SearchControlElementAdditionInMenuGeneratorContext
,SearchStringElementAdditionInFormGeneratorContext
,SearchStringElementAdditionInMenuGeneratorContext
,SlaveElementBaseGeneratorContext
,SlaveFormElementBaseGeneratorContext
,SubMenuGeneratorContext
,SwitcherGeneratorContext
,TableColumnGeneratorContext
,TableColumnsGroupGeneratorContext
,TableGeneratorContext
,TextDecorationGeneratorContext
,TextDocFieldGeneratorContext
,TextFieldGeneratorContext
,TrackBarGeneratorContext
,TumblerBaseGeneratorContext
,ViewStatusRepresentationElementAdditionInFormGeneratorContext
- All Known Implementing Classes:
CalendarFieldGeneratorContextImpl
,ChartGeneratorContextImpl
,CheckBoxAsTumblerGeneratorContextImpl
,CheckBoxGeneratorContextImpl
,CommandBarGeneratorContextImpl
,ContextMenuGeneratorContextImpl
,DendrogramGeneratorContextImpl
,FlowchartGeneratorContextImpl
,FormattedDocGeneratorContextImpl
,FormButtonGeneratorContextImpl
,GanttChartGeneratorContextImpl
,GeographicalMapGeneratorContextImpl
,HTMLGeneratorContextImpl
,HyperlinkButtonGeneratorContextImpl
,ImageFieldGeneratorContextImpl
,InputFieldGeneratorContextImpl
,LogicGroupGeneratorContextImpl
,MainElementGeneratorContextImpl
,MenuButtonGeneratorContextImpl
,MenuButtonsGroupGeneratorContextImpl
,MoxelGeneratorContextImpl
,NavigatorGeneratorContextImpl
,PageGeneratorContextImpl
,PagesGeneratorContextImpl
,PanelGeneratorContextImpl
,PeriodFieldGeneratorContextImpl
,PictureDecorationGeneratorContextImpl
,PlannerGeneratorContextImpl
,ProgressBarGeneratorContextImpl
,RadioGroupAsTumblerGeneratorContextImpl
,RadioGroupGeneratorContextImpl
,SearchControlElementAdditionInFormGeneratorContextImpl
,SearchControlElementAdditionInMenuGeneratorContextImpl
,SearchStringElementAdditionInFormGeneratorContextImpl
,SearchStringElementAdditionInMenuGeneratorContextImpl
,SubMenuGeneratorContextImpl
,SwitcherGeneratorContextImpl
,TableColumnGeneratorContextImpl
,TableColumnsGroupGeneratorContextImpl
,TableGeneratorContextImpl
,TextDecorationGeneratorContextImpl
,TextDocFieldGeneratorContextImpl
,TextFieldGeneratorContextImpl
,TrackBarGeneratorContextImpl
,ViewStatusRepresentationElementAdditionInFormGeneratorContextImpl
public interface ElementBaseGeneratorContext extends IElementGeneratorContext
A representation of the model object 'Element Base Generator Context'.The following features are supported:
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description ClientInterfaceVariant
getInterfaceVariant()
Returns the value of the 'Interface Variant' attribute.FormVisualEntity
getPLogFormElement()
Returns the value of the 'PLog Form Element' reference.IElementGeneratorContext
getPParent()
Returns the value of the 'PParent' reference.LFTargetPlatform
getTargetPlatform()
Returns the value of the 'Target Platform' attribute.void
setInterfaceVariant(ClientInterfaceVariant value)
Sets the value of the 'Interface Variant
' attribute.void
setPLogFormElement(FormVisualEntity value)
Sets the value of the 'PLog Form Element
' reference.void
setPParent(IElementGeneratorContext value)
Sets the value of the 'PParent
' reference.void
setTargetPlatform(LFTargetPlatform value)
Sets the value of the 'Target Platform
' attribute.
-
-
-
Method Detail
-
getPLogFormElement
FormVisualEntity getPLogFormElement()
Returns the value of the 'PLog Form Element' reference.- Returns:
- the value of the 'PLog Form Element' reference.
- See Also:
setPLogFormElement(FormVisualEntity)
,LayoutGenerationContextPackage.getElementBaseGeneratorContext_PLogFormElement()
-
setPLogFormElement
void setPLogFormElement(FormVisualEntity value)
Sets the value of the 'PLog Form Element
' reference.- Parameters:
value
- the new value of the 'PLog Form Element' reference.- See Also:
getPLogFormElement()
-
getPParent
IElementGeneratorContext getPParent()
Returns the value of the 'PParent' reference.- Returns:
- the value of the 'PParent' reference.
- See Also:
setPParent(IElementGeneratorContext)
,LayoutGenerationContextPackage.getElementBaseGeneratorContext_PParent()
-
setPParent
void setPParent(IElementGeneratorContext value)
Sets the value of the 'PParent
' reference.- Parameters:
value
- the new value of the 'PParent' reference.- See Also:
getPParent()
-
getTargetPlatform
LFTargetPlatform getTargetPlatform()
Returns the value of the 'Target Platform' attribute. The literals are from the enumerationLFTargetPlatform
.- Returns:
- the value of the 'Target Platform' attribute.
- See Also:
LFTargetPlatform
,setTargetPlatform(LFTargetPlatform)
,LayoutGenerationContextPackage.getElementBaseGeneratorContext_TargetPlatform()
-
setTargetPlatform
void setTargetPlatform(LFTargetPlatform value)
Sets the value of the 'Target Platform
' attribute.- Parameters:
value
- the new value of the 'Target Platform' attribute.- See Also:
LFTargetPlatform
,getTargetPlatform()
-
getInterfaceVariant
ClientInterfaceVariant getInterfaceVariant()
Returns the value of the 'Interface Variant' attribute. The literals are from the enumerationClientInterfaceVariant
.- Returns:
- the value of the 'Interface Variant' attribute.
- See Also:
ClientInterfaceVariant
,setInterfaceVariant(ClientInterfaceVariant)
,LayoutGenerationContextPackage.getElementBaseGeneratorContext_InterfaceVariant()
-
setInterfaceVariant
void setInterfaceVariant(ClientInterfaceVariant value)
Sets the value of the 'Interface Variant
' attribute.- Parameters:
value
- the new value of the 'Interface Variant' attribute.- See Also:
ClientInterfaceVariant
,getInterfaceVariant()
-
-